Potty training for men involves more than just learning how to use the toilet properly It encompasses a range of habits and practices that contribute to overall hygiene and health Proper potty training for men involves techniques such as wiping correctly, flushing the toilet after use, and washing hands thoroughly These may seem like basic habits, but they go a long way in maintaining cleanliness and preventing the spread of germs and bacteria.

One of the main reasons why men’s potty training matters is because it affects not just the men themselves, but also the people around them Improper potty habits can lead to unhygienic conditions in public restrooms, which can be a breeding ground for bacteria and viruses This can pose serious health risks for everyone, not just the person with the poor potty habits By practicing proper potty training, men can contribute to a cleaner and safer environment for everyone.

Another reason why men’s potty training is important is because it impacts personal hygiene and self-care Poor potty habits can lead to unpleasant odors, infections, and other health issues By maintaining good potty practices, men can ensure that they stay clean and healthy This is not just for their own benefit, but also for the people around them Good personal hygiene contributes to a positive self-image and overall well-being.
